Subject: Re: [PATCH ath-next] wifi: ath9k: owl: move name into owl_nvmem_probe

Rosen Penev <rosenp@gmail.com> writes:
> There is no need for dynamic allocation for a simple string.
> request_firmware_nowait copies the string internally anyway.
>
> The error message on failure is also wrong. It's an allocation failure,
> not a find failure.
